Fractional deep dermal ablation induces tissue tightening

Summary
Fractional deep dermal ablation (FDDA) offers a safer alternative to traditional skin resurfacing. This new laser treatment effectively improves photodamaged skin with minimal adverse events.

Background:
- Traditional ablative resurfacing carries significant risks.
- Fractional deep dermal ablation (FDDA) was developed as a safer, less invasive alternative.
- This study investigates FDDA for treating photodamaged skin.
Purpose of the Study:
- To evaluate the safety and efficacy of fractional deep dermal ablation (FDDA) for skin resurfacing.
- To assess clinical and histological outcomes of FDDA in treating photodamaged skin.
- To compare FDDA with traditional ablative resurfacing methods.
Main Methods:
- A prototype fractional CO(2) laser device was used for treatments.
- Initial treatments were performed on forearms, followed by a multi-center study on faces and necks.
- Subjects received 1-2 treatments with varying energy densities and densities.
- Clinical and histological assessments were conducted at multiple follow-up points.
- Improvement in rhytides, pigmentation, texture, laxity, and overall appearance was evaluated.
Main Results:
- FDDA demonstrated an improved safety profile compared to traditional ablative resurfacing.
- Both epidermal and dermal tissue resurfacing were effectively achieved.
- Treatments were well-tolerated, with no serious adverse events reported.
- Eighty-three percent of subjects showed moderate or better overall improvement.
Conclusions:
- Fractional deep dermal ablation (FDDA) is a safe and promising treatment for skin resurfacing.
- FDDA effectively targets both epidermal and deep dermal tissue.
- This modality represents a significant advancement in treating photodamaged skin.
